In the maritime industry, safety is of utmost importance. One essential component of this safety framework is the presence of a rescue tug. A rescue tug is a specialized vessel designed to assist ships in distress, providing support during emergencies such as engine failure, grounding, or adverse weather conditions. The role of a rescue tug is crucial in ensuring that larger vessels can be safely navigated back to port or to a safe anchorage. Without these tugs, the consequences of maritime accidents could be far more severe, leading to potential loss of life and environmental disasters.The operations of a rescue tug are not limited to just towing distressed vessels. They are equipped with advanced technology and trained personnel who can perform various tasks, including firefighting, oil spill response, and medical assistance. This versatility makes them invaluable assets in maritime operations. For instance, if a cargo ship experiences a fire on board, a rescue tug can quickly respond to the situation, providing firefighting capabilities while also securing the ship to prevent it from drifting into dangerous waters.Moreover, the presence of a rescue tug enhances the overall safety of maritime operations. Shipping companies often hire these tugs to accompany their vessels through particularly treacherous waters or during challenging weather conditions. This proactive approach not only protects the crew and cargo but also minimizes the risk of accidents that could have dire consequences for the environment and local communities.The training and qualifications of the crew on a rescue tug are also critical. These professionals must be skilled in navigation, emergency response, and the use of specialized equipment. Regular drills and training exercises ensure that they are prepared for any situation they may encounter at sea. This level of preparedness is vital, as time is often of the essence when responding to maritime emergencies.In conclusion, the importance of a rescue tug cannot be overstated. These vessels play a pivotal role in ensuring the safety of maritime operations, providing essential support during emergencies, and helping to protect both lives and the environment. As the shipping industry continues to grow, the demand for rescue tugs will likely increase, highlighting the need for continued investment in these critical resources. Ultimately, the presence of a rescue tug represents a commitment to safety and responsibility in an industry that operates in one of the most unpredictable environments on Earth.
